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will conduct a thorough inspection of your home’s subfloor to identify the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ture and assess the severity of the damage.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, and our team will provide you with a detailed report of their findings.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using industrial-strength pumps and vacuums, we’ll extract as much water as possible from the affected area. Our team will work quickly to prevent further damage and ensure that your home remains safe and healthy.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, ensuring that your home is free from moisture and humidity. Our team will work tirelessly to restore your floors to their original condition.

Step 4: Mold Remediation

If mold or mildew has developed, our team will use specialized equipment and techniques to remove it completely. We’ll ensure that your home is safe and healthy, and that the mold and mildew won’t come back.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air

Once the affected area has been dried and treated,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is done to your satisfaction. We’ll make any necessary repairs and provide you with a comprehensive report of our work.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ak under the sink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ained leaks.
Major water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Call a professional for major water damage, it’s not a small job.
Water damage from a clogged drain Yes No DIY is fine for clogged drains, but be sure to take necessary precautions.
Water damage from a hurricane No Yes Call a professional for extensive water damage from a natural disaster.
Water damage in a crawl space No Yes Call a professional for water damage in areas that are difficult to access.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ost In Tarpon Springs, FL

The cost of Subfloor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the project. Factors that affect the cost include the type of equipment needed, the amount of labor required, and any more repairs or treatments necessary.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Depends on the amount of water extracted and the equipment needed.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ed.
Mold Remediation $1,500 – $4,000 Depends on the severity of the mold and the equipment needed.
Final Inspection and Repair $500 – $2,000 Depends on the scope of the repairs needed.
